Teeth whitening involves the specific application of chemical bleaching agents directly to human dental enamel. Dentists offer professional treatments in their clinical offices, and patients often purchase various over-the-counter products at local pharmacies. Because teeth naturally yellow over long periods of time, many people ask dental professionals about these cosmetic procedures. Signs of Discoloration Individuals may think about teeth whitening when they begin to see discoloration on their teeth. Skin tags are small, benign growths of flesh hanging lightly from the surface of the body. Because these lesions often experience repeated friction against clothing or jewelry, individuals may seek out various removal methods. Dermatological clinics offer quick and simple procedures for skin tag removal, or you can explore other at-home options. Professional Treatments Medical professionals utilize highly effective methods for skin tag removal. Because dermatologists undergo extensive training, they can accurately identify the exact nature of the lesion before proceeding. Vascular disease damages the network of blood vessels running throughout your body, and they normally keep your brain functioning at an optimal level. Because debilitating strokes happen suddenly, understanding underlying vascular conditions may help you stay physically safe. Proper medical education directly gives you the necessary tools for better daily management of vascular disease. Foot and ankle surgery addresses conditions that affect mobility, stability, and overall foot function. Advances in surgical techniques continue to improve how specialists treat injuries, deformities, arthritis, and other foot and ankle concerns. Foot doctors, also called podiatrists, specialize in diagnosing and treating a range of conditions that affect the lower extremities. They provide targeted interventions to help you manage pain and navigate daily mobility issues. A comprehensive foot evaluation identifies the cause of your symptoms, and it guides the development of a personalized treatment plan. Menopausal hormone therapy can help manage symptoms that occur as hormone levels change during menopause. It is often used to address concerns such as hot flashes, night sweats, mood changes, and vaginal dryness, depending on a patient’s health history and treatment goals. Botox is a widely recognized cosmetic treatment derived from botulinum toxin type A. In the field of facial aesthetics, practitioners use it to temporarily alter the appearance of specific facial lines and wrinkles. Many individuals seek this procedure for aesthetic reasons, but it also has various applications in general medicine. Understanding the nature of this substance is the first step for anyone exploring aesthetic modifications. Introduction to Botox Botox is a purified protein formulation utilized in both cosmetic and therapeutic settings. Facial plastic surgery encompasses procedures that alter, restore, or reshape the structures of the face and neck. Reconstructive surgery aims to repair physical deformities caused by injuries or medical conditions, helping to restore functionality and improve quality of life. Cosmetic surgery focuses on enhancing appearance by refining or reshaping features. Both fields of plastic surgery require a deep understanding of anatomy.
